I have a question, Team A commits an intentional foul against a player of Team B, before team B shoot the free throws a player of Team B commits a technical foul, first Team B shoot two free throws then Team A shoot two free throws, Which Team should maintain possession of the ball? The way the rules are set up - the team that shoots the T ( team A) takes the ball out of bounds. You shoot 2 and get the ball.
I believe that is the correct interpetation of the rule. Lets see if I get corrected.

Coach Mac -
I don't think the arrow has anything to do with it ( just me ) Team A intentionally fouls Team B ( or gets a T ) Team A shoots the FTs and gets the ball out of bounds.
Example - ( Ever hear of an 8 point play? ) We got a back door lay up, made the shot and got fouled +2 The kid said something and got a T - we made all 3 FTs +3 - got the ball out of bounds and hit a 3 -- 8 point play going into the locker room. Turned a deficit into a 2 point lead.
Moral of the story - KNOW your opponent... NEVER foul and good shooting team. (unless you absolutely have to)
